DEPARTMENT OF BUILDINGS AND GROUNDS

Department of Buildings and Grounds, including maintenance of public convenience stations, and $5,000 exclusively for test borings and soil investigations, $2,435,000, of which $30,000 shall be payable from the highway fund. CONSTRUCTION SERVICES, DEPARTMENT OP BUILDINGS AND GROUNDS

All apportionments of appropriations for the use of the Department of Buildings and Grounds in payment of personal services, retirement costs of persons employed on construction work, and other expenses provided for by said appropriations shall be based on an amount not exceeding 6 per centum of appropriations for such construction projects, and appropriations specifically made in this Act for the preparation of plans and specifications shall be deducted from any allowances authorized under this paragraph: Provided, That reimbursements may be made to this fund from appropriations contained in this Act for services rendered other activities of the District government, without reference to fiscal-year limitations on such appropriations: Provided further, That this fund shall be available for advance planning subject to subsequent reimbursement from funds loaned by the Administrator of General Services under the provisions of the Act of October 13, 1949 (63 Stat. 841). OFFICE OF SURVEYOR

Office of Surveyor, $200,000. DEPARTMENT OF LICENSES AND INSPECTIONS

Department of Licenses and Inspections, including the enforcement of the Act requiring the erection of fire escapes on certain buildings and the removal of dangerous or unsafe or insanitary buildings; compensation at rates to be fixed by the Commissioners of members of boards to survey unsafe structures and excavations; administration and enforcement of zoning regulations; purchase of two passenger motor vehicles for replacement only; maintenance and repairs to markets; purchase of commodities and for personal services m connection with investigation and detection of sales of short weight and measure; and to obtain evidence necessary for prosecution in connection with the business of pawnbrokers, mediums, secondhand dealers, and other businesses requiring a license; $2,294,000. DEPARTMENT OF HIGHWAYS AND TRAFFIC

Department of Highways and Traffic, including minor construction of bridges; rental, purchase, installation, and maintenance of radio services; purchase of twenty-one passenger motor vehicles including eighteen for replacement only; and purchase of driver-training vehicles from proceeds of sale of similar vehicles; $8,045,000, of which $5,083,000 shall be payable from the highway fund: Provided,^ That the Commissioners are hereby authorized to purchase and install a municipal asphalt plant including all auxiliary plant equipment to be paid for from this appropriation: Provided further, That the Commissioners are authorized and empowered to pay the purchase price and the cost of installation of new parking meters or devices from fees collected from such new meters or devices, which fees are hereby appropriated for such purposes.
